The Ukrainian President has said that Vladimir Putin does not “want to end the war” and that he does not want peace, he wants to continue trying to capture Ukraine.

Volodymyr Zelensky said that Putin is continuing to build his army and he could go further with the war.

During an interview with the Economist President Zelensky said, “Since today the world is slowly stopping Putin, slowly, too slowly, he will come. And this is a fact. I recently gave an example.

“I just received this from the Security Service, from my two intelligence services. I always take from several sources, then look, analyse and can share information when I see a large number of coincidences.”

The Ukrainian leader said that last year Putin hired an additional 140,000 soldiers and it is clear Putin does not want to end the war.

He said, “Putin, about whom someone says, ‘that he may even want peace’ in the world, in Europe, in America.

“Look, he does not want to end or stop anything. He does not want peace. The question of ‘forcing’ -we will talk about this. He does not want it.”

“He [Putin] does not want to end the war. In addition to these 140,000, he is preparing 150,000 in 2025. Another 150,000. More than ten divisions, I don’t remember exactly, 12-15 divisions will be formed by Putin. This is a fact.”

He said that Ukraine has “all the documents that he is forming this.

“Moreover, his goal is to send them all for military training, military exercises in Belarus,” Zelensky said.

“As for all the documents, everything coincides with the fact that he will send them. This is no different from what happened in Ukraine on the eve [of a full-scale war],” the President of Ukraine said.

“This is preparing a springboard for offensive actions,” Zelensky said.

“The question is that no one in America is thinking about this yet. Well, they think, okay, the Ukrainian president is raising the stakes, wants to say that there may be an offensive. Okay, there has already been an offensive on Ukraine. First of all, he [Putin] will do it with a large number of troops. Secondly, who told you that he will go to Ukraine? Who told you that he will not go to Lithuania? To Poland?” Zelensky said.

Zelensky suggested that Putin’s offensive could have happen much earlier than the West expects, he added, “Maybe, while we are still standing, he is preparing a bridgehead for a large number of troops and simply takes this bridgehead and goes in another direction.

“He goes to Poland, goes to Lithuania and occupies them. Why does no one think that this will happen?”
